Dune Tirari McLaren Vale Red Blend 2020 (Australia)
- French oak
- Blue & black fruit
- Sweet herb
- Punchy acidity
The TIRARI is a vibrant medium bodied red. 2020 It is made from Touriga, Mourvèdre, Negroamaro and Grenache with a dash of Montepulciano, with 12 months in seasoned French hogsheads prior to bottling. Bright red fruited lift, white pepper, sweet herbs lift then blue and black fruits, amaro bitter herbs, chinotto like lift. Palate is fine and bright, punchy acid and lovely feathery tannin, lively and fresh with an array of sour red fruits, blue fruits and some amaro bitter notes.
A cool spring with windy conditions led to a delay in bud-burst, but the season then saw record temperatures in late December. This was followed by a mild January/February. Yields were below average in shiraz and cabernet but healthy crops on most other varieties. 2020 whites are showing delicacy in their aromatics, with fresh natural acidity. The 2020 reds are displaying bright red-fruited fragrance with great intensity on the palate. The resulting wines have an even tannin structure giving depth and longevity with an elegance of fruit.
